China’s India: A Research Proposal

 

主讲人:Wen-hsin Yeh, Morrison Professor, Department of History and Director, Institute of East Asian Studies, UC Berkeley

 

It is commonplace in modern discourses to represent China in contrast to the West. Yet culturally, historically and in many other ways, India stands no less significantly for a cultural “other” to China’s “self.” Before Europe, India was China’s “West.” Thanks to Europe, India became, in the 20th century, part of the timeless and benighted “East,” along with China, where metaphysics triumphed over science.

For more than two centuries, interactions between China and India have been mediated in evolving international contexts of colonialism, socialism, postcolonialist nationalism and post-socialist modernization. China and India shared not so much a borderline as a shifting zone carved by peaks and valleys and ceaselessly traversed by a multitude of people of diverse ethnicities, languages, and beliefs. China’s India is at once a symbolic sign and a material place. Interactions between the two societies have transformed lives both within and outside China and fashioned the styles of existence in southwest China. In this presentation, Professor Wen-hsin Yeh will elaborate on some of these themes and lay the groundwork for a proposed joint interdisciplinary research project for Tsinghua and Berkeley.

 

 

China and Her Neighbors

主讲人:Robert Scalapino, Robson Professor Emeritus, Department of Political Science and Founding Director, Institute of East Asian Studies, UC Berkeley

 

Professor Robert Scalapino will offer his views on China’s   relationships with its strategic neighbors — Korea, Mongolia, India, Southeast Asian countries, Indonesia, Japan, and others — and discuss the global ramifications of such relationships beyond the regional context.
